The first open source chip is now available to protect your bitcoin

The first open source chip is now available to protect your bitcoin

The corporate Tropic Sq. introduced on October 6 that its Tropic01 safety chip formally entered manufacturing and is already obtainable in “everybody by means of a distributors community.”

It’s a Protected and open supply component chipa sort of microcomponent designed to guard data saved in digital gadgets, together with Bitcoin custody tools (BTC) and cryptocurrencies similar to Wallets.

Firms similar to Ledger, Trezor and others specialised within the manufacture of bodily wallets for cryptocurrency self -system, make use of any such chips as an important a part of their security techniques.

“Tropic01 is the primary chip of its class that may be audited and verified repeatedly within the business,” they are saying from Tropic Sq.. Its open design permits builders look at their operation, establish vulnerabilities and strengthen their defenses Over time.

From Tropic Sq. they argue that this mannequin seeks to advertise transparency in a subject the place the closed code has historically predominated, as utilized in most business pockets {hardware}.

The chip, in response to the announcement, can already be built-in into improvement plates similar to Raspberry Pi, Arduino or Mikroe, and in addition has a USB-C model. The worth of every Tropico1 chip is 5 euros.

In such a manner, startups or corporations can combine a verifiable security module into gadgets for the Web of Issues (IoT), to industrial techniques or monetary options.

Belief improvement is important, as a result of digital gadgets are underneath fixed assault. Our open method assumes that actuality. Tropic01 is not only one other chip, however a dwelling safety course of that evolves with every risk.

Jan Pleskac, govt and co -founder director of Tropic Sq..

With the manufacturing already in progress, the launch of Tropic01 marks a major step within the seek for safety options clear and verifiable to guard non-public keys that defend the BTC and the knowledge saved in different digital gadgets.
